/*!
 * 8keys API
 * COPYRIGHT (c) 2020 FATECH.DEV
 */.general-page{display:flex;flex-direction:column;min-height:100vh}.general-page .container{max-width:1100px;padding:0 15px;width:auto}.general-page .footer{background-color:#f5f5f5}.login-box .logo{margin:5px 0;max-height:100%;width:80%}::-webkit-scrollbar{width:7px}::-webkit-scrollbar-track{background:#f4f6f9}::-webkit-scrollbar-thumb{background:#d04d5a}::-webkit-scrollbar-thumb:hover{background:#dc3545}*{scrollbar-color:#d04d5a #f4f6f9;scrollbar-width:thin}a{cursor:pointer}.w-1{width:1px}.w-2{width:2px}.w-4{width:4px}.w-8{width:8px}.w-12{width:12px}.w-16{width:16px}.w-20{width:20px}.w-24{width:24px}.w-32{width:32px}.h-1{height:1px}.h-2{height:2px}.h-4{height:4px}.h-8{height:8px}.h-12{height:12px}.h-16{height:16px}.h-20{height:20px}.h-24{height:24px}.h-32{height:32px}.d-grid{display:grid}.cursor-pointer{cursor:pointer}.navbar-nav>.user-menu>.dropdown-menu>li.user-header{height:100px}.layout-fixed .main-sidebar{overflow-x:hidden}.nav-sidebar>.nav-item.has-treeview>.nav-link.active{background-color:rgba(0,0,0,.1)!important;color:#212529!important}.nav-pills .nav-link:not(.active):hover{color:#777}.nav-treeview>.nav-item>.nav-link.active,.nav-treeview>.nav-item>.nav-link.active:hover{background-color:#dc3545!important;color:#fff!important}.flex-dual-center{align-items:center;display:flex;flex-direction:column;justify-content:center}table.object-details{width:100%}table.object-details tr td,table.object-details tr th{padding:.5rem 0;vertical-align:top}table.object-details tr th{letter-spacing:.5px;width:10rem}table.object-details.wide-headers tr th{width:16rem}img.cover{max-height:10rem;max-width:20rem}img.pk_image{max-height:3rem;max-width:20rem}.app_links{text-align:center}@media (min-width:768px){.app_links{text-align:left}}.app_links img.android{height:4.4rem}.app_links img.apple{height:3rem}.dashboard_review_link{color:#1f2d3d!important;font-weight:bolder}.custom-file-input+label{overflow:hidden;padding-right:5rem;text-overflow:ellipsis;white-space:nowrap}td.yellow-star .fa-star{color:#ffc453;margin-right:.2rem}.top-deal{background:#fff2d9!important}.top-deal td.name .fa-star{color:#ffc453;margin-right:.2rem}.top-deal:last-child td{border-bottom:2px solid #ffd2a1}.top-deal td{border-top:2px solid #ffd2a1}.top-deal+.top-deal td{border-top:none}.top-deal+tr:not(.top-deal) td{border-top:2px solid #ffd2a1}.top-deal td:first-child{border-left:2px solid #ffd2a1}.top-deal td:last-child{border-right:2px solid #ffd2a1}.checkout-total{border-top:2px solid #999;font-weight:700}.checkout-product td{line-height:2rem;vertical-align:middle}.checkout-product td img{height:2rem}.shopping-cart .loading-animation{display:none}.shopping-cart .img-circle{height:3rem;width:3rem}.shopping-cart.shopping-cart-loading{background-color:#d1d1d1}.shopping-cart.shopping-cart-loading .loading-animation{align-items:center;display:flex;height:6rem;justify-content:center}.shopping-cart.shopping-cart-loading .loading-animation i{font-size:2rem}.shopping-cart.shopping-cart-loading .dropdown-divider{border-top:1px solid #bcbebf}.shopping-cart .cart-items{max-height:23.5rem;overflow-y:scroll}.shopping-cart .dropdown-item{-webkit-user-select:none;-moz-user-select:none;user-select:none}.shopping-cart .dropdown-item .media{align-items:center}.shopping-cart .dropdown-item .media .media-body{max-width:320px}.shopping-cart .dropdown-item .shopping-cart-title{font-size:1.2rem;font-weight:700}.shopping-cart .dropdown-item .dropdown-item-title{align-items:center;display:flex}.shopping-cart .dropdown-item .dropdown-item-title .product-title{overflow:hidden;text-overflow:ellipsis}.shopping-cart .dropdown-item.active,.shopping-cart .dropdown-item:active,.shopping-cart .dropdown-item:hover{background-color:transparent;color:#212529}.shopping-cart .dropdown-footer{font-size:.9rem;font-weight:700}.shopping-cart .dropdown-footer.total{text-align:right}.products-export-merchant-icon{max-height:.7rem}.buttons-in-head{margin:-.15rem}.buttons-in-head a,.buttons-in-head button{margin:.15rem}@media (max-width:575px){.buttons-in-head{margin-top:.5rem}}.nav-sidebar .nav-header:not(:first-of-type){padding-top:1.1rem}.dashboard-chart .card-body{position:relative}.dashboard-chart .chart-loading{color:#dc3545;left:0;position:absolute;right:0;text-align:center;top:45%;transition:display .1s ease-in}div:not(:empty).copy-clipboard,h5:not(:empty).copy-clipboard,small:not(:empty).copy-clipboard,span:not(:empty).copy-clipboard,strong:not(:empty).copy-clipboard,td:not(:empty).copy-clipboard{cursor:pointer}div:not(:empty).copy-clipboard:not(.no-icon):after,h5:not(:empty).copy-clipboard:not(.no-icon):after,small:not(:empty).copy-clipboard:not(.no-icon):after,span:not(:empty).copy-clipboard:not(.no-icon):after,strong:not(:empty).copy-clipboard:not(.no-icon):after,td:not(:empty).copy-clipboard:not(.no-icon):after{-webkit-font-smoothing:antialiased;color:#70b5ff;content:"\f0c5";display:inline-block;font-family:Font Awesome\ 6 Pro;font-style:normal;font-variant:normal;font-weight:500;padding-left:4px;text-rendering:auto}.swal2-container .swal2-popup{width:40rem}.swal2-container .swal2-popup .swal2-title{font-size:1.3rem}.swal2-container .swal2-popup .swal2-styled.swal2-confirm{background-color:#28a745}.swal2-container .swal2-popup .swal2-styled.swal2-confirm:focus{box-shadow:0 0 0 3px rgba(30,126,52,.5)}.nav-sidebar>.nav-select-merchant{background-color:unset;border:unset;border-bottom:1px solid #dee2e6;margin-bottom:.5rem;padding:.5rem}.nav-sidebar>.nav-select-merchant label{margin-bottom:.1rem}footer.main-footer{align-items:center;display:flex;justify-content:space-between}.card .card-header,.card .card-title{font-weight:700}.accordion .card>a{color:unset}.product-card{background-color:#f5f5f5;font-size:1.1rem;width:100%}.product-card table{margin-bottom:1rem;width:100%}.product-card table th{width:6rem}.product-card table .cover{padding:.5rem 0;text-align:center}.product-card table .name{font-size:1.4rem;font-weight:700;text-align:center}.ai-enhancer .bg-match{background-color:#c8e6c9}.ai-enhancer .bg-different{background-color:#ffd9d9}.ai-enhancer .bg-different,.ai-enhancer .bg-match{border-radius:.25rem;padding:.2rem .3rem}.ai-enhancer .product-changes input:-moz-placeholder-shown,.ai-enhancer .product-changes textarea:-moz-placeholder-shown{background-color:#f5f5f5}.ai-enhancer .product-changes input:placeholder-shown,.ai-enhancer .product-changes textarea:placeholder-shown{background-color:#f5f5f5}.ai-enhancer div.dataTables_wrapper div.dataTables_processing{position:relative}.product-search{align-items:center;display:flex;gap:1rem;margin:.25rem 0}.product-search .cover{align-items:center;display:flex;height:4rem;justify-content:center;width:4rem}.product-search .cover img{max-height:4rem;max-width:4rem}.product-search .info .name{font-weight:700}.product-search-dropdown{background-color:#fcfcfc}.product-search-dropdown .select2-results>.select2-results__options{max-height:24rem}.jstree .jstree-anchor{font-size:1.1rem}.gap-1{gap:.25rem}.gap-2{gap:.5rem}.gap-3{gap:1rem}.gap-4{gap:1.5rem}.gap-5{gap:2rem}[aria-expanded=false]>.expanded,[aria-expanded=true]>.collapsed{display:none}.select2-dropdown{z-index:1060}@media (min-width:992px){.modal-xxl{max-width:800px}}@media (min-width:1200px){.modal-xxl{max-width:1140px}}@media (min-width:1800px){.modal-xxl{max-width:1740px}}.countries-list{display:grid;gap:.25rem;grid-template-columns:repeat(auto-fill,minmax(2rem,1fr));margin:0 -.5rem;max-height:16rem;overflow-y:auto;padding:0 .5rem}.countries-list .badge{font-size:90%}div.dataTables_wrapper table.dataTable .dtr-data:empty:after,div.dataTables_wrapper table.dataTable td:empty:after,table.fill-empty td:empty:after{content:"-"}div.dataTables_wrapper table.dataTable td.reorder{text-align:left}div.dataTables_wrapper table.dataTable tr.drag-source{background-color:rgba(255,193,7,.1)}div.dataTables_wrapper table.dataTable tr.drag-target{background-color:rgba(2,116,216,.1)}.DTE .DTE_Header_Content{font-size:110%;font-weight:600}.DTE_Action_Create input#DTE_Field_password::-moz-placeholder{opacity:0}.DTE_Action_Create input#DTE_Field_password::placeholder{opacity:0}.DTE_Label_Info{font-size:.9rem;font-weight:400}.DTED p.lead{font-weight:400}@media screen and (min-width:992px){.DTED>.modal-dialog{max-width:800px}}@media screen and (min-width:1200px){.DTED>.modal-dialog{max-width:1000px}}.dynamic_input_wrapper>div{display:flex;flex-direction:column;justify-content:flex-end}.dynamic_input_wrapper>div label{font-size:.75rem}table.dataTable .actions{grid-gap:8px 4px;display:grid;grid-template-columns:repeat(5,1fr)}table.dataTable .actions button,table.dataTable .actions>a{align-items:center;display:flex;height:1.8rem;justify-content:center;width:2rem}.editor-multiselect{background-color:hsla(0,0%,100%,.1);padding:.75rem}.editor-multiselect .nav-link{padding:.35rem .5rem}.editor-multiselect .tab-content{margin-top:.5rem}.editor-multiselect .tab-content h5{border-bottom:1px solid hsla(0,0%,100%,.3);padding-bottom:.3rem}div.dataTables_wrapper div.dataTables_processing{background-color:#a1d2d9;position:fixed}.ticket-details .ticket-conversation{height:100%}.ticket-details .ticket-conversation .card-header{border-bottom:none;padding:1rem 1.25rem}.ticket-details .ticket-conversation .card-header .card-title{font-size:1.2rem}.ticket-details .ticket-conversation .ticket-messages{display:flex;flex-direction:column;gap:1rem}.ticket-details .ticket-conversation .ticket-message{display:flex;flex-direction:column;gap:.5rem;min-width:20rem}.ticket-details .ticket-conversation .ticket-message .details{display:flex;justify-content:space-between}.ticket-details .ticket-conversation .ticket-message .details .name{font-weight:700}.ticket-details .ticket-conversation .ticket-message .details .date{color:#666}.ticket-details .ticket-conversation .ticket-message .content{border-radius:.5rem;padding:.75rem 1rem}.ticket-details .ticket-conversation .ticket-message .content:has(+.attachments-wrapper){border-bottom-left-radius:0;border-bottom-right-radius:0}.ticket-details .ticket-conversation .ticket-message .content+.attachments-wrapper{border-top-left-radius:0;border-top-right-radius:0}.ticket-details .ticket-conversation .ticket-message .attachments-wrapper{background-color:rgba(0,0,0,.6);border-radius:.5rem;color:#fff;font-weight:700;padding:.5rem 1rem;width:100%}.ticket-details .ticket-conversation .ticket-message .attachments-wrapper a{color:#fff}.ticket-details .ticket-conversation .ticket-message .attachments-wrapper .attachments{display:flex;flex-wrap:wrap;gap:.5rem}.ticket-details .ticket-conversation .ticket-message .attachments-wrapper .attachment{background-color:rgba(0,0,0,.25);border-radius:.5rem;padding:.25rem .5rem;transition:background-color .2s}.ticket-details .ticket-conversation .ticket-message .attachments-wrapper .attachment:hover{background-color:rgba(0,0,0,.4)}.ticket-details .ticket-conversation .ticket-message.left{align-self:flex-start}.ticket-details .ticket-conversation .ticket-message.left .content{background-color:rgba(0,0,0,.05)}.ticket-details .ticket-conversation .ticket-message.right{align-self:flex-end}.ticket-details .ticket-conversation .ticket-message.right .details .name{order:1}.ticket-details .ticket-conversation .ticket-message.right .content{background-color:#007bff;color:#fff}.ticket-details .ticket-conversation .ticket-message.right .content a{color:#fff}.ticket-details .ticket-conversation .ticket-message.system{max-width:none;width:100%}.ticket-details .ticket-conversation .ticket-message.system .content{align-self:center;background-color:rgba(0,0,0,.06);border-radius:.5rem;color:#555;padding:.6rem 1rem;text-align:center}.ticket-details .ticket-details .card-body{display:flex;flex-direction:column;gap:.75rem;max-height:70vh;overflow-y:auto}.ticket-details .ticket-details .card-body hr{margin:.5rem 0;width:100%}.ticket-details .ticket-details .field .label{color:#666;font-size:.9rem;font-weight:700}.ticket-details .ticket-items{display:flex;flex-direction:column;gap:.5rem}.ticket-details .ticket-items .ticket-item{background-color:rgba(0,0,0,.05);border-radius:.5rem;padding:1rem .75rem}.ticket-details .ticket-items .ticket-item .code{margin:.5rem 0}.ticket-details .ticket-items .ticket-item .code img{max-height:4rem;max-width:100%}.ticket-details .ticket-items .ticket-item .resolution{align-items:center;display:flex;gap:.5rem}.ticket-details .ticket-items .ticket-item .resolution span.resolution-inner{color:#28a745;font-weight:700}
